Measure, segment, and communicate enterprise assistant usage to prove value and guide responsible expansion.
In 2025, most knowledge workers can access some form of conversational assistant, yet actual usage varies widely. Leadership teams need to know whether assistants are solving real problems, which personas benefit, and where guardrails or training lag. Without credible metrics, champions struggle to secure budget, and skeptics claim assistants are novelty tools. This lesson introduces a measurement framework inspired by large-scale workplace surveys, adapted to keep results vendor neutral and privacy conscious.
